#30278e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#30278e is composed of 18.8% red, 15.3%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.2% cyan, 72.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 44.3% black. It has a hue angle of 245.2 degrees, a saturation of 56.9% and a lightness of 35.5%. #30278e color hex could be obtained by blending #604eff with #00001d.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#30278e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#30278e has RGB values of R:48, G:39, B:142 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0.73, Y:0,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 3155854.

Shades and Tints of #30278e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010104 is the darkest color, while #f4f3f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#30278e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#58585d is the less saturated color, while #1304b1 is the most saturated one.
